Eligibility Criteria
and Educational Qualifications
|
Course Name |
Requirements for
Admission |
|
B.V.Sc & A.H Programme |
12th
(Intermediate) with Physics, Chemistry, Biology/Biotechnology, and English |
|
B.Tech (Biotechnology) |
12th
with PCB or PCM and English (60% for Gen/OBC, 55% for SC/ST) |
|
B.Tech (Dairy Technology) |
12th
with Physics, Chemistry, Biology/Maths, and English (60% for Gen/OBC, 55% for
SC/ST) |
|
Bachelor of Fisheries Science |
12th
with PCB/Biotech and English (60% for Gen/OBC, 55% for SC/ST) |
|
Diploma in Vet Pharmacy |
12th
with Physics, Chemistry, Biology, and English (50% for Gen/OBC, 45% for
SC/ST) |
|
M.V.Sc and Ph.D |
Passed
or appearing in B.V.Sc & AH; Master's degree for Doctorate |
|
M.Sc (Biotechnology) |
Bachelor's
degree in Life Sciences or Biological Sciences |
o Candidates must have passed or be appearing in their 10+2
exams.
o Core subjects required are Physics, Chemistry, and Biology
or Mathematics depending on the course.
o English is a mandatory subject for all undergraduate
programs.
o Most B.Tech courses require at least 60% marks for General
and OBC students.
o For SC and ST students, the minimum requirement is 55%
marks.
o For Diploma courses, the limit is 50% for General/OBC and
45% for SC/ST.
o For Master's programs, a relevant Bachelor's degree is
required.
o For PhD programs, a relevant Master's degree in the specific
subject is necessary.
